
导言:
近期有用户反馈 TP(TokenPocket/TP钱包)在升级后出现无法使用、交易失败或资产显示异常的情况。本文从技术与产品、用户安全与治理、以及未来技术趋势角度,做全方位分析,并提出应对与前瞻性建议,覆盖防重放、种子短语与动态安全等要点。
一、升级后不能用的常见原因
1) 兼容性问题:升级引入的新协议或前端改动,可能与旧版本数据格式不兼容。2) 节点或 RPC 改变:钱包默认节点下线或链侧升级(hard fork、分支)造成链上交互失败。3) 签名/ABI变化:针对新链或新代币的签名逻辑变更,导致交易被拒绝。4) 本地数据损坏:升级过程中权限或存储迁移失败,导致钱包账户无法读取。5) 恶意升级或假版:不排除钓鱼/篡改导致应用失效或资产风险。
二、防重放(Replay Protection)详解与实务
1) 概念:重放攻击指在一条链上签名的交易被复制到另一条链执行,造成资产重复转移。防重放常用手段为链 ID(如 EIP-155)、交易序列化差异或链上回滚保护。2) 对用户影响:链分叉或跨链资产迁移时,若钱包未正确实现防重放,可能导致签名在两个链上都生效。3) 建议:开发者在升级时必须明确链 ID 处理、支持签名版本管理并在 UI 明示目标链;用户在跨链或分叉期间避免批量签名操作,优先在小额或测试交易中验证。
三、种子短语(Seed Phrase)与恢复策略
1) BIP39 原理与风险:种子短语是私钥的根,任何泄露即意味着资产全部风险。升级过程中切勿在非官方或网络表单中输入助记词。2) 恢复步骤:若钱包升级后失效,可使用原始种子在官方/兼容客户端或硬件钱包上恢复,但应先确认客户端官方性与防钓鱼。3) 强化建议:启用额外的 passphrase(BIP39 passphrase)、分布式备份(社交恢复或阈值签名)以及离线冷备份。
四、动态安全(Dynamic Security)实践
1) 定义:动态安全强调基于行为、环境与风险评分的实时认证与反应,而非单一静态手段。2) 实现措施:设备指纹、异常交易检测、时间/地理限制、基于链上和链下数据的实时风控。3) 升级考虑:钱包升级应保持安全策略连续性,支持回滚与迁移日志,提供可视化风险提示。
五、创新科技前景(短中长期)
1) 多方计算(MPC)与阈值签名:可降低单点私钥风险,更易实现无缝云+端混合托管。2) 硬件信任环境(TEE/安全元件):配合手机与桌面设备提升签名安全。3) 账户抽象(Account Abstraction):让合约账户承担更多逻辑(恢复、支付手续费模型),减少用户直接操作密钥的频率。4) 去中心化身份(DID)与可组合凭证将把钱包延展为身份与权限管理的枢纽。
六、市场预测与行业影响
1) 钱包市场:非托管钱包将继续增长,用户对安全与易用的需求拉升对 MPC、硬件结合方案的付费意愿。2) 监管与合规:隐私保护与 KYC 之间将寻求平衡,合规压力可能推动托管或半托管产品并存。3) 生态整合:钱包将从“资产管理”向“身份+资产+服务”整合,成为 Web3 入口。

七、未来智能社会的场景想象
在智能社会中,钱包不再只是私钥容器,而是个人数字代理:自动支付订阅、授权 IoT 设备、参与 DAO 決策并作为数字身份的凭证。动态安全与隐私保护将成为基础设施级能力,钱包升级将像手机系统更新一样常态化,但需更强的回退与兼容保障。
八、给用户与开发者的实操建议
用户:1) 升级前备份好种子短语并离线存储;2) 在升级后如出现异常,先查官方公告、社区及 GitHub issues;3) 尽量在小额交易中验证新版本;4) 必要时用硬件钱包恢复并转移资产。开发者:1) 实施严格的回滚与迁移策略,提供清晰迁移文档;2) 实装并测试防重放机制、链 ID 管理与签名兼容性;3) 加入动态风控、用户可视化提示与多层恢复选项;4) 在发行新版本前进行灰度发布和兼容性回归测试。
结语:
TP钱包或其他非托管钱包在升级后出现问题并非罕见,关键在于生态方与用户如何通过技术规范、透明沟通与成熟的恢复/备份机制把风险降到最低。未来钱包将演化为智能代理与身份核心,动态安全与防重放等底层能力将成为决定平台生死的关键。
评论
小周
这篇分析很全面,尤其是防重放和动态安全那段,学到了。升级前备份真不能省。
CryptoFan88
建议里提到用小额测试交易非常实用。我之前一次升级没测就转大额,差点出事。
晴天
关于 MPC 和账户抽象的展望写得好,让人对未来钱包更有期待。
WalletGuru
开发者角度的落地建议很到位,灰度发布和回滚策略确实是关键。
匿名用户
提醒大家别随便把助记词输入到新版本的弹窗里,这条真是血的教训。